Broker Review Red Flags: Spotting the Deception

Navigating the brokerage landscape can be challenging. Uncovering red flags early on is crucial to avoiding potential scams and choosing a reputable broker.

Here are some common warning signs to look an eye on:

* **Too-good-to-be-true promises:** If a broker guarantees unrealistic returns or flaunts unusually high profits, it's a major red flag. Be skeptical of any claims that seem too perfect to be true.

* **Lack of transparency:** A trustworthy broker will be open about their fees, policies, and record.

Avoid from brokers who are vague or evasive when answering your questions.

* **Pressure tactics:** Legitimate brokers won't force you into making immediate decisions. Take your time to investigate your options and compare different brokers before committing.

* **Unlicensed or unregistered brokers:** Ensure the broker you select is properly licensed and registered with relevant financial authorities in your region.

By observing these red flags, you can steer through the brokerage world with certainty. Remember, doing your due diligence is essential for preserving your financial well-being.

Capital Scam Alert: Is Your Broker Legit?

Be cautious when trusting the sphere of investments. Sadly, deceptive brokers are prowling on unsuspecting people seeking to expand their wealth.

It's crucial to validate the legitimacy of any broker before handing over your capital. Here are some strategies to help you identify a legitimate broker:

* Explore the broker's credentials thoroughly. Check with regulatory bodies like the CFTC for registration.

* Analyze online reviews from other investors. Be wary of overly glowing reviews that seem contrived.

* Grasp the broker's commissions and investment design. Avoid brokers with hidden fees or a complex platform.

* Communicate with the broker directly to ask clarification about their offerings. Pay attention to their availability.

Remember, protecting your financial well-being starts with being an informed and vigilant investor. Don't let con artists take advantage of your belief.
